Additional Features:


Auto lid opening / closing: Can be provided at loading / unloading station.

Unloading chute : This is a funnel shaped flat chute made of PP / SS which allows for easier unloading of components onto a basket from the barrel.

Drip tray : This novel arrangement helps in reduction of carry-over of solution at each station, by directly placing a pneumatically operated or rack and pinion type tray below the barrel, while it is being lifted out of a tank. The collected solution is then drained into a pipe manifold and sent directly to the ETP.
This substantially reduces the contamination at each station by over 15%.

Drip accelerator :
This design feature helps in a faster drip of the solution from the barrel, thus reducing the drip time at each station and at the same time decreasing the carry-over of solution by over 30%.

Reversible direction of rotation : By reversing the rotation of the barrel after lifting, the components are made to tumble with greater efficiency, thus increasing the flow of the drip. This results in reduced carry-over at each rotation station as well as during traversing.

Direct drive / Chain drive : Such drive mechanisms are designed, depending on the operational requirements.

Fume Exhauster : Provided on transport wagons for exhausting fumes emanating from the barrel during transit.
